Jamie Laike Tsui of Capsule Computers writes:
"Roccat’s new top of the line gaming keyboard is the Roccat Isku. It is an illluminated rubber domed type keyboard with medium height keys, eight physical macro keys, a large wrist rest, and eight media keys. It features a powerful set of drivers and it is the first Roccat keyboard to support the Roccat Talk feature. Paired with a Roccat Kone[+], Kone Pure, or a Kone XTD, the two devices are able to work together to create macros that can perform functions on both devices at the same time."
